What does this quiz measure?
It explores self-worth, comfort with receiving care, and patterns in close relationships. It does not measure inherent value or confirm how any specific person feels.
Is this a mental health assessment or diagnosis?
No. It is a reflective questionnaire and cannot diagnose any condition or replace professional evaluation.
How long does it take and how many questions are included?
Completion typically takes about 10 minutes. The quiz includes 15 questions.
How should responses be selected?
Select the option that best matches typical thoughts, feelings, and behavior rather than a recent exception. Answer based on overall patterns across time and situations.
What should be done if the results cause distress?
Consider discussing the concerns with a trusted person or a qualified professional. Seek urgent help if there is risk of self-harm or inability to stay safe.

Am I Lovable Quiz - Symptoms and Signs

Wondering whether you are lovable often reflects how you see yourself, receive affection, and approach close relationships—not whether you possess enough value to deserve love. This free, no-sign-up quiz uses 15 reflective questions to explore stable self-worth, receptivity to care, and authentic mutual connection. It cannot prove how anyone else feels or measure your inherent worth, and it is not a mental health assessment. If this question brings persistent distress, consider talking with someone you trust or a qualified professional.
